WHERE IS SELEN?



Selenium is present in foods such as mackerel, tuna, anchovies, herring, snapper, salmon, sardines (sea fish have the most selenium), shellfish (oysters, scallops). , lobster), in mushrooms, egg yolks, whole grains, sunflower seeds, nuts, yeast, rice germ…. However, it should be noted that selenium is easily destroyed when foods are refined or processed through many stages. So, eating a variety of raw, unprocessed foods is also a good way to get selenium in your diet.

Therefore, you should eat foods rich in selenium to provide the necessary source of selenium for the body, help the body develop normally and reduce the risk of diseases caused by selenium deficiency. Supplement with drugs only when prescribed by a doctor for the following cases: people who smoke, drink alcohol, use birth control pills, people with ulcerative colitis, people who have just had surgery...

SELEN SIDE EFFECTS


When taking selenium with medicine, there may be some side effects such as diarrhea, garlic breath, and sweat, hair loss, irritability, itchy skin, nausea, vomiting... The body's needs will cause chronic intoxication with manifestations such as hair loss, skin lesions, and central nervous system disorders. Therefore, without a doctor's prescription, you should not supplement with selenium by medicine, but should use natural foods with selenium sources for safety.
